|
@@ -32,14 +32,15 @@ export default (state = initSearchList, action) => {
|
|
|
const tempArrs = newState.assistLabel;
|
|
|
let tmpString = '';
|
|
|
for (let i = 0; i < tempArr.length; i++) {
|
|
|
- if (tempArr[i].questionId == action.id) {
|
|
|
+ if (tempArr[i].questionId == action.id && i == action.idx) {
|
|
|
tempArr[i].time = getCurrentDate();
|
|
|
tempArrs.push(tempArr[i]);
|
|
|
newState.assistLabel = [...tempArrs];
|
|
|
}
|
|
|
}
|
|
|
for (let j = 0; j < tempArrs.length; j++) {
|
|
|
- tmpString += (tempArrs[j].name+(tempArrs[j].value?(':'+tempArrs[j].value)+', ':': ')+(tempArrs[j].time?'报告日期:'+tempArrs[j].time:'')+';')
|
|
|
+ let tmpVal = tempArrs[j].value?tempArrs[j].value.trim():tempArrs[j].value;
|
|
|
+ tmpString += (tempArrs[j].name+(tmpVal?(':'+tmpVal)+', ':': ')+(tempArrs[j].time?'报告日期:'+tempArrs[j].time:'')+';')
|
|
|
}
|
|
|
newState.dataString = tmpString
|
|
|
return newState;
|
|
@@ -54,7 +55,8 @@ export default (state = initSearchList, action) => {
|
|
|
return
|
|
|
}
|
|
|
for (let i = 0; i < tempArr.length; i++) {
|
|
|
- tmpString += (tempArr[i].name+(tempArr[i].value?(':'+tempArr[i].value)+', ':': ')+(tempArr[i].time?'报告日期:'+tempArr[i].time:'')+';')
|
|
|
+ let tmpVal = tempArr[i].value?tempArr[i].value.trim():tempArr[i].value;
|
|
|
+ tmpString += (tempArr[i].name+(tmpVal?(':'+tmpVal)+', ':': ')+(tempArr[i].time?'报告日期:'+tempArr[i].time:'')+';')
|
|
|
}
|
|
|
newState.assistLabel = [...tempArr]
|
|
|
newState.dataString = tmpString
|
|
@@ -69,7 +71,8 @@ export default (state = initSearchList, action) => {
|
|
|
tempArr[i].value = action.val
|
|
|
newState.assistLabel = [...tempArr]
|
|
|
}
|
|
|
- tmpString += (tempArr[i].name+(tempArr[i].value?(':'+tempArr[i].value)+', ':': ')+(tempArr[i].time?'报告日期:'+tempArr[i].time:'')+';')
|
|
|
+ let tmpVal = tempArr[i].value?tempArr[i].value.trim():tempArr[i].value;
|
|
|
+ tmpString += (tempArr[i].name+(tmpVal?(':'+tmpVal)+', ':': ')+(tempArr[i].time?'报告日期:'+tempArr[i].time:'')+';')
|
|
|
}
|
|
|
newState.dataString = tmpString
|
|
|
return newState;
|
|
@@ -83,7 +86,8 @@ export default (state = initSearchList, action) => {
|
|
|
tempArr[i].time = action.date
|
|
|
newState.assistLabel = [...tempArr]
|
|
|
}
|
|
|
- tmpString += (tempArr[i].name+(tempArr[i].value?(':'+tempArr[i].value)+', ':': ')+(tempArr[i].time?'报告日期:'+tempArr[i].time:'')+';')
|
|
|
+ let tmpVal = tempArr[i].value?tempArr[i].value.trim():tempArr[i].value;
|
|
|
+ tmpString += (tempArr[i].name+(tmpVal?(':'+tmpVal)+', ':': ')+(tempArr[i].time?'报告日期:'+tempArr[i].time:'')+';')
|
|
|
}
|
|
|
newState.dataString = tmpString
|
|
|
return newState;
|